Seagate BarraCuda 1TB 100% Disk Usage

A BarraCuda 1TB can show 100% active time during legitimate work, SMR housekeeping, paging, antivirus scans or a failing I/O path. This guide separates high activity from a drive that is becoming unsafe.

Quick answer

100% disk usage is a utilization signal, not a diagnosis. Check the process generating I/O, response time, transfer rate, free space, memory pressure and SMART health. Back up first when 100% usage comes with freezes, I/O errors, clicking, disappearing or SMART warnings.

Exact-model reference

BarraCuda 1TB exact-model troubleshooting reference

ModelTypeStatusForm factorRecordingRPMCacheBest fit
ST1000DM014Desktop HDDCurrent3.5-inch, 20.2mmSMR7,200256MBCurrent desktop identification and replacement matching
ST1000DM010Desktop HDDOlder/legacy3.5-inch, 20.2mmCMR7,20064MBExisting-system diagnosis and condition-aware replacement
ST1000LM048Laptop HDDOlder mobile line2.5-inch, 7mmSMR5,400128MBLaptop diagnosis, cloning and SATA SSD replacement
ST1000DM003Desktop HDDLegacy3.5-inch, 26.1mmCMR7,20064MBExisting-system identification and recovery triage
ST1000DM004Desktop HDD / SEDLegacy security variant3.5-inch, 26.1mmCMR7,20064MBExact-model identification before replacement

Use the exact label before applying firmware, warranty, form-factor or replacement guidance. A retailer title or capacity selector is not enough to identify the drive.

What 100% active time means

Windows can report 100% active time even when throughput is low because requests are waiting. It does not by itself prove failure. Pair it with latency, queueing, errors, transfer rate and the workload that created the activity.

Identify DM014, DM010 or LM048

ST1000DM014 and ST1000LM048 use SMR, so long write-heavy activity can expose cache and media-management limits. ST1000DM010 is CMR, but age and condition often matter more than its recording method.

Normal short-lived causes

Windows updates, antivirus scans, game installs, indexing, backup jobs and large copies can saturate a mechanical disk temporarily. The key questions are whether the activity stops and whether the system remains responsive.

SMR write behavior

On DM014 and LM048, a long incoming write can be fast at first and then slow when cached data must be reorganized. This can produce high active time and low throughput without proving physical damage.

Low memory and paging

A computer with insufficient RAM can continuously move memory pages to the HDD. The disk becomes the bottleneck even when it is healthy. Check memory pressure before replacing the drive solely because Task Manager says 100%.

Search indexing and background services

Indexing, cloud synchronization, telemetry, antivirus and update services can generate many small random requests. Identify the process before disabling services. A temporary test is more useful than permanent blanket tweaks.

Low free space

A nearly full drive has less room for filesystem allocation and SMR housekeeping. Freeing space can improve behavior, but it does not erase SMART warnings or repair media damage.

Response time and throughput

100% active time with acceptable response and expected workload can be normal. Extremely high latency, repeated timeouts, zero-byte transfers or I/O errors require health and connection checks.

Check the data path

A weak SATA cable, controller issue or enclosure bridge can cause retries that look like poor drive performance. Review CRC errors and try a known-good cable or port before concluding the platters are at fault.

Health checks before optimization

Copy important data before running extended tests when the drive freezes, clicks, disconnects or reports SMART problems. Optimization is secondary to preserving the only copy.

When an SSD is the right fix

A healthy HDD can still be the wrong boot drive for a modern, multitasking Windows system. Moving the operating system and active applications to an SSD while retaining the HDD for bulk storage can solve the workload mismatch.

Replacement decision

Replace the drive when diagnostics fail, SMART indicators worsen, errors persist across known-good cabling, or the mechanical behavior becomes unstable. Upgrade rather than replace like-for-like when the real problem is random-I/O demand.

Frequently asked questions

Seagate BarraCuda 1TB 100% Disk Usage questions

Is 100% disk usage always a bad drive?

No. It can be caused by normal background work, paging or a workload that saturates a mechanical disk.

Why is speed low while usage is 100%?

The disk may be waiting on many small requests, retries or SMR media management rather than transferring one large sequential stream.

Does ST1000DM014 SMR cause 100% usage?

SMR can contribute during long write-heavy workloads, but Windows services, memory pressure and health problems must also be checked.

Will disabling SysMain fix it?

It may change activity on some systems, but it should not be the first universal fix. Identify the process and health state first.

Can low RAM cause the problem?

Yes. Heavy paging can keep a mechanical drive saturated.

How much free space should I keep?

Keeping meaningful free space helps general filesystem behavior and gives SMR models more working room. It does not substitute for backups.

Should I run a benchmark while the drive freezes?

Protect data first. A benchmark adds workload and may be inappropriate when there are errors, clicking or disconnections.

Can a SATA cable cause high disk usage?

Retries from a bad cable or port can increase latency and active time. Check the interface path and CRC errors.

Would a SATA SSD be faster?

Yes for boot, application launch and small random I/O. An HDD may remain useful for bulk, mostly-read storage.

When is replacement justified?

Failed diagnostics, worsening SMART values, repeated I/O errors, mechanical symptoms or persistent instability after system checks justify replacement.
